# Copyright (c) Jupyter Development Team.
# Distributed under the terms of the Modified BSD License.
import json
import os
import os.path as osp
import shutil
import tarfile
from glob import glob
from pathlib import Path
from tempfile import TemporaryDirectory
from jupyter_releaser import util
PACKAGE_JSON = util.PACKAGE_JSON
def build_dist(package, dist_dir):
"""Build npm dist file(s) from a package"""
# Clean the dist folder of existing npm tarballs
os.makedirs(dist_dir, exist_ok=True)
dest = Path(dist_dir)
for pkg in glob(f"{dist_dir}/*.tgz"):
os.remove(pkg)
if osp.isdir(package):
basedir = package
tarball = osp.join(package, util.run("npm pack", cwd=package).split("\n")[-1])
else:
basedir = osp.dirname(package)
tarball = package
data = extract_package(tarball)
# Move the tarball into the dist folder if public
if not data.get("private", False) == True:
shutil.move(str(tarball), str(dest))
elif osp.isdir(package):
os.remove(tarball)
if not osp.isdir(package):
return
if "workspaces" in data:
all_data = dict()
for pattern in _get_workspace_packages(data):
for path in glob(osp.join(basedir, pattern), recursive=True):
path = Path(path)
package_json = path / "package.json"
if not osp.exists(package_json):
continue
data = json.loads(package_json.read_text(encoding="utf-8"))
if data.get("private", False) == True:
continue
data["__path__"] = path
all_data[data["name"]] = data
i = 0
for (name, data) in sorted(all_data.items()):
i += 1
path = data["__path__"]
util.log(f'({i}/{len(all_data)}) Packing {data["name"]}...')
tarball = path / util.run("npm pack", cwd=path, quiet=True)
shutil.move(str(tarball), str(dest))
def extract_dist(dist_dir, target):
"""Extract dist files from a dist_dir into a target dir"""
names = []
paths = sorted(glob(f"{dist_dir}/*.tgz"))
util.log(f"Extracting {len(paths)} packages...")
for package in paths:
path = Path(package)
data = extract_package(path)
name = data["name"]
# Skip if it is a private package
if data.get("private", False): # pragma: no cover
util.log(f"Skipping private package {name}")
continue
names.append(name)
pkg_dir = target / name
if not pkg_dir.parent.exists():
os.makedirs(pkg_dir.parent)
tar = tarfile.open(path)
tar.extractall(target)
tar.close()
if "main" in data:
main = osp.join(target, "package", data["main"])
if not osp.exists(main):
raise ValueError(f"{name} is missing 'main' file {data['main']}")
shutil.move(str(target / "package"), str(pkg_dir))
return names
def check_dist(dist_dir):
"""Check npm dist file(s) in a dist dir"""
tmp_dir = Path(TemporaryDirectory().name)
os.makedirs(tmp_dir)
util.run("npm init -y", cwd=tmp_dir)
names = []
staging = tmp_dir / "staging"
names = extract_dist(dist_dir, staging)
install_str = " ".join(f"./staging/{name}" for name in names)
util.run(f"npm install {install_str}", cwd=tmp_dir)
shutil.rmtree(str(tmp_dir), ignore_errors=True)
def extract_package(path):
"""Get the package json info from the tarball"""
fid = tarfile.open(path)
data = fid.extractfile("package/package.json").read()
data = json.loads(data.decode("utf-8"))
fid.close()
return data
def handle_npm_config(npm_token, dist_dir):
"""Handle npm_config"""
npmrc = Path(dist_dir) / Path(".npmrc")
registry = os.environ.get("NPM_REGISTRY", "https://registry.npmjs.org/")
text = f"registry={registry}"
if npm_token:
registry = registry.replace("https:", "")
registry = registry.replace("http:", "")
text += f"\n{registry}:_authToken={npm_token}"
if npmrc.exists():
text = npmrc.read_text(encoding="utf-8") + text
npmrc.write_text(text, encoding="utf-8")
def get_package_versions(version):
"""Get the formatted list of npm package names and versions"""
message = ""
data = json.loads(PACKAGE_JSON.read_text(encoding="utf-8"))
if data["version"] != version:
message += f"\nPython version: {version}"
message += f'\nnpm version: {data["name"]}: {data["version"]}'
if "workspaces" in data:
message += "\nnpm workspace versions:"
for pattern in _get_workspace_packages(data):
for path in glob(pattern, recursive=True):
text = Path(path).joinpath("package.json").read_text()
data = json.loads(text)
message += f'\n{data["name"]}: {data["version"]}'
return message
def tag_workspace_packages():
"""Generate tags for npm workspace packages"""
if not PACKAGE_JSON.exists():
return
data = json.loads(PACKAGE_JSON.read_text(encoding="utf-8"))
tags = util.run("git tag").splitlines()
if not "workspaces" in data:
return
for pattern in _get_workspace_packages(data):
for path in glob(pattern, recursive=True):
sub_package_json = Path(path) / "package.json"
sub_data = json.loads(sub_package_json.read_text(encoding="utf-8"))
tag_name = f"{sub_data['name']}@{sub_data['version']}"
if tag_name in tags:
util.log(f"Skipping existing tag {tag_name}")
else:
util.run(f"git tag {tag_name}")
def _get_workspace_packages(data):
"""Get the workspace packages for a package given package data"""
if isinstance(data["workspaces"], dict):
packages = []
for value in data["workspaces"].values():
packages.extend(value)
else:
packages = data["workspaces"]
return packages
